city council Meeting 6-21-94 . Santa Monica, California
ORDINANCE NUMBER 1752 (CCS)
(city Council Series)
A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E
CITY OF SANTA MONICA ADDING SECTION 2.48.030
TO THE MUNICIPAL CODE TO CREATE THE POSITION
OF COMMISSIONER EMERITUS ON THE COMMISSION
ON OLDER AMERICANS
TH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F SANTA MONICA DOES ORDAIN AS
FOLLOWS:
SECTION 1.
section 2.48.030 is hereby added to the Santa
Monica Municipal Code to read as follows:
SECTION
2.48.030.
commissioner(s)
Emeritus.
One or more commissioner(s)
Emeritus shall be appointed to the Commission
on older Americans (IICommission") by the City
Council based upon the recommendations of the
commission. To be eligible for appointment to
such a position, a person must have served two
full terms as a Commissioner on the Commission
and shall be active in the Santa Monica
community.
Each Commissioner Emeritus shall
be a nonvoting member of the Commission, may
represent the Commission at community and
1
other functions as directed by the Commission,
may serve on commission committees, and shall
abide by the bylaws of the Commission. There
shall be no limit to the number of
Commissioners Emeri tus appointed to the
commission, each of whom shall serve a two
year term as a Commissioner Emeritus.
Unlimited term renewals of Commissioners
Emeritus can by made by the City Council upon
the recommendation of the Commission.
SECTION 2. Any provision of the Santa Monica Municipal Code
or appendices thereto inconsistent with the provisions of this
ordinance, to the extent of such inconsistencies and no further,
are hereby repealed or modified to that extent necessary to affect
the provisions of this Ordinance.
SECTION 3. If any section, subsection, sentence, clause, or
phrase of this Ordinance is for any reason held to be invalid or
unconsti tutional by a decision of any court of any competent
jurisdiction, such decision shall not affect the validity of the
remaining portions of this Ordinance. The City Council hereby
declares that it would have passed this Ordinance, and each and
every section, subsection, sentence, clause, or phrase not declared
invalid or unconstitutional without regard to whether any portion
of the Ordinance would be subsequently declared invalid or
2
unconstitutional.
SECTION 4. The Mayor shall sign and the City Clerk shall
attest to the passage of this Ordinance. The City Clerk shall
cause the same to be published once in the official newspaper
within 15 days after its adoption. This Ordinance shall become
effective after 30 days from its adoption.
